New Adhesive Luting Composite for Implant-retained Restorations
 
Amherst, NY (July 7, 2009) – Ivoclar Vivadent, Inc. is pleased to announce the release of Multilink® Implant, an adhesive luting composite specifically designed for the placement of fixed, implant-retained restorations. Multilink Implant is a self- -curing, two-component cement with a light-cure option that permanently bonds indirect restorations made of glass-ceramic, oxide ceramic metal, and metal-ceramic to implant abutments.
            Compared to glass-ionomer and conventional cements, Multilink® Implant offers low solubility and high mechanical strength establishing a more durable bond between the restoration and the abutment.  When used in combination with Monobond Plus universal primer, Multilink Implant provides high-level, adhesive bond strengths to all restorative and abutment materials. 
            Multilink Implant offers the advantage of direct dispensing from an automix syringe and easy clean-up of excess cement.   The shade range is based on the shades of current ceramic abutments including “MO 0,”  “MO 1” as well as  “Transparent.”  As a result, margins are invisible.
